#2E7673 Color
#2E7673 is rgb(46, 118, 115) in RGB, hsl(178, 44%, 32%) in HSL, and about cmyk(61%, 0%, 3%, 54%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Myrtle Green (#317873),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.39.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#2E7673 Channel Values
How #2E7673 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 46 · G 118 · B 115 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 178° · S 44% · L 32%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 178° · S 61% · V 46%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 61% · M 0% · Y 3% · K 54%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.31:1 vs white · 3.96: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#2E7673 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#2E7673 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#2E7673?
#2E7673 is a dark teal — rgb(46, 118, 115) in RGB and hsl(178, 44%, 32%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Myrtle Green (#317873),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.39.
What is the RGB value of #2E7673?
#2E7673 is rgb(46, 118, 115) — red 46, green 118, and blue 115 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#2E7673?
#2E7673 converts to approximately cmyk(61%, 0%, 3%, 54%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#2E7673 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#2E7673 scores 5.31:1 against white and 3.96: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#2E7673 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#2E7673 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is teal (#008080) at a CIE76 distance of 8,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
